V-MAN wrote:Saw this bike on the top of the homepage ... It's SWEET. Who does it belong to and are there more pictures?
Like WM already said, it's Andy's "Stingray" bike. One of the very first SS bikes at all in 2007 - it's SS bike #4. The new owner has a Chrysler dealership and painted it black with a snake head on the tank and renamed it "Viper". As far as I heard it's reimported to Florida.

When I have been at Andy's shop in spring of 2007 and saw this SS bike I fell in love with it and ordered one for myself.
